Fri. August 16, 2013: Day 1, Part 4



Just a brief update to finish off day 1....

Although I would have been up for going to MK for some play time, Em wasn’t feeling up to it after a long travel day so we returned to the room and did what anyone named DisneyKid4Life (yes you Rob) would do… Stacey TV! She’s so adorable!

DSCN2418.jpg

Rob: I’m not sure if you can read Stacey’s lips but you can see in her eyes that she is warning you that future rides with Ariel in your Splash log could materially alter your relationship. Don’t say I didn’t warn you!


I wanted to catch a Bedtime with Duffy segment but we never seemed to be back in the room before 10pm when the segments end. For this first night at WDW we ended up watching classic Donald Duck cartoons with the sounds of a raging thunderstorm outside. Absolute. Perfection!

DSCN2427.jpg

As much as I wanted to get comfy and change clothes, our bags didn’t arrive until after 10:15pm. All were present and accounted for. We didn’t need but one bag since we were transferring to AKL the next day. As difficult as it is for me, everything stayed in the bags.
